Bourne won the last time they faced Greater New Bedford RVT, and things went their way on Wednesday too. The Bourne Canalmen walked away with a 3-1 victory over the Greater New Bedford RVT Bears.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Canalmen.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-22, 25-23, 22-25, 25-23.
Bourne was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 20 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least 16 aces in three consecutive games.
Bourne has been performing well recently as they've won seven of their last nine contests, which lines up perfectly with their 14-4 record this season. As for Greater New Bedford RVT, they dropped their record down to 15-6 with the loss, which was their fourth straight on the road.
